摘要: 一、线程池 1、concurrent.futures模块 介绍 concurrent.futures模块提供了高度封装的异步调用接口 ThreadPoolExecutor:线程池,提供异步调用 ProcessPoolExecutor: 进程池,提供异步调用 在这个模块中进程池和线程池的使用方法完全一 阅读全文
posted @ 2018-12-09 17:20 从入门到出师 阅读(374) 评论(0) 推荐(0) 编辑
摘要: 进程 场景 利用多核、高计算型的程序、启动数量有限 进程是计算机中最小的资源分配单位 进程和线程是包含关系 每个进程中都至少有一条线程 可以利用多核,数据隔离 创建 销毁 切换 时间开销都比较大 随着开启的数量增加 给操作系统带来负担 线程 高IO型 调度是我们不能干预的 我们只能写我们自己的逻辑 阅读全文
posted @ 2018-12-09 17:17 从入门到出师 阅读(544) 评论(0) 推荐(0) 编辑
摘要: 一、local 在多个线程之间使用threading.local对象,可以实现多个线程之间的数据隔离 import time import random from threading import Thread,local loc = local() def func1(): global loc 阅读全文
posted @ 2018-12-09 17:16 从入门到出师 阅读(521) 评论(0) 推荐(0) 编辑
摘要: 一、pymysql模块 1、说明: 想在python代码中连接上mysql数据库,就需要使用pymysql模块, pymysql是在 Python3.x 版本中用于连接 MySQL 服务器的一个库,在Python2中则使用mysqldb。 Django中也可以使用PyMySQL连接MySQL数据库。 阅读全文
posted @ 2018-12-09 17:15 从入门到出师 阅读(333) 评论(0) 推荐(0) 编辑
摘要: 块级标签和行内标签 div和span标签的特点: 没有自带的样式,方便后续使用CSS调整样式! 块级标签: 自己独占一行! div、p、h1~h6、hr 行内标签(内联标签): 默认都在一行显示! span、a、label、b、i、u、s 标签嵌套 1. 块级标签可以包含内联标签 2. p标签不能包 阅读全文
posted @ 2018-12-09 17:14 从入门到出师 阅读(163) 评论(0) 推荐(0) 编辑
摘要: 一、CSS介绍 概念: CSS(Cascading Style Sheet,层叠样式表)定义如何显示HTML元素 当浏览器读到一个样式表,它就会按照这个样式表来对文档进行渲染 语法:每个CSS样式由两个组成部分:选择器和声明。声明又包括属性和属性值。每个声明之后用分号结束 span {width: 阅读全文
posted @ 2018-12-09 17:14 从入门到出师 阅读(180) 评论(0) 推荐(0) 编辑
摘要: CSS属性 一、宽和高 width属性可以为元素设置宽度。 height属性可以为元素设置高度。 块级标签才能设置宽度,内联标签的宽度由内容来决定。 div {width: 1000px;background-color: red} /*块级标签设置了width会生效*/ span {width: 阅读全文
posted @ 2018-12-09 17:13 从入门到出师 阅读(2813) 评论(0) 推荐(0) 编辑
摘要: 一、%s msg = '我叫%s,今年%s,性别%s' %('帅哥',18,'男') print(msg) # 我叫帅哥,今年18,性别男 二、format # 三种方式: # 第一种:按顺序接收参数 s1 = '我叫{},今年{},性别{}'.format('帅哥','18','男') print 阅读全文
posted @ 2018-12-09 17:04 从入门到出师 阅读(469) 评论(0) 推荐(0) 编辑
摘要: 一、JavaScript概述 1、ECMAScript和JavaScript的关系 1996年11月,JavaScript的创造者--Netscape公司,决定将JavaScript提交给国际标准化组织ECMA,希望这门语言能够成为国际标准。 次年,ECMA发布262号标准文件(ECMA-262)的 阅读全文
posted @ 2018-12-09 17:03 从入门到出师 阅读(129) 评论(0) 推荐(0) 编辑
摘要: 一、JS流程控制 1、 1.if else var age = 19; if (age > 18){ console.log("成年了"); }else { console.log("小孩子"); } 2.if-else if-else var age = 19; if (age > 18){ co 阅读全文
posted @ 2018-12-09 17:02 从入门到出师 阅读(342) 评论(0) 推荐(0) 编辑